Jeffrey John Stoll

Jeffrey John Stoll's health struggles were many, and after years of being strong, and fighting to live, his weary body gave out. On Sunday July 14, 2024, at age 63, he died peacefully with his family by his side at Harmony Care Facility in Dubuque, lowa.  A visitation will be held on Sunday, July 21, 2024 from 10:30 am to 1 pm at Temple Hill Church in Cascade, Iowa, with a prayer service at noon.  A luncheon and a celebration of his life will follow in the church hall.  A private family burial will be at a later date.

Jeff was born May 31, 1961 in Monticello, IA. He was the youngest son of Loras and Dola (Till) Stoll.

Jeff graduated from Monticello High School as well as Ashford University. He held various jobs throughout his life, but because of many health issues, it became hard to work. He enjoyed working and being helpful.

The best day of Jeff's life was Feb 22, 1996, when he welcomed his daughter, Lucinda Ann, into this world. She was his "pride and joy", and a constant ray of sunshine.

Jeff was always kind, caring, loving father, and a great baby brother. He cherished his time with Lucinda and his family. He loved the Chicago Cubs, Bears, strawberry licorice, dressing sharp, desserts, and a little coffee with his cream.

He leaves behind his loving and beautiful daughter Lucinda Sam, and her husband, Greg. Ten siblings: Pat (Jeanne), Jim (Kim), Ed (Margie), Tom (Evelyn), Jane Steger and Skeeter, Lois (Dale) Andrews, Robert (Linda), Julie (Tom) Weiler, Alan, and Ruth (Donnie) Ungs. He had many nieces and nephews, and his cat, Jack.

Jeff was preceded in death by his parents, brother John, and his niece and nephew.

The family would like to extend a very special thank you to Dr. John Whalan for taking such good care of Jeff the past 30 years, also Tri-State Dialysis, Hospice of Dubuque, and the staff at Harmony for all of their excellent care.

In lieu of flowers, a memorial fund has been established.
